The rotator cuff is a group of four muscles that surround the shoulder joint, like a cuff, and work together to move and stabilise the shoulder. These muscles and their tendons work together with the deltoid muscle to provide motion and strength to the shoulder for all waist-level and shoulder-level or above activities.
